Helicobacter pylori eradication treatment and the risk of Barrett's esophagus and esophageal adenocarcinoma

Abstract
Background null Helicobacter pylori (H. pylori) is associated with lower risks of Barrett's esophagus and esophageal adenocarcinoma, but whether H. pylori eradication increases the risk of these conditions is unknown.
